Talk4Endo’ is a new podcast brought to you by Endometriosis UK, helping break down the barriers in talking about menstrual health and raising awareness of endometriosis, a condition that affects 1.5 million women and those assigned female at birth in the UK. Despite affecting so many, endometriosis is widely unknown. 54% of people have never heard of it, rising to 74% of men. Listen to our podcast to hear people’s real life stories and learn more about this hidden condition.     This summer hundreds of people are walking 7.5km in solidarity for those waiting an average of 7.5 years to be diagnosed with endometriosis. This episode is your walking companion, as we speak to retired GB Olympic Rower Beth Bryan, Eastenders & Game of Thrones Actress Alice Nokes, endometriosis expert Professor Andrew Horne, Neelam Heera from Cysters and Hannah Bardell MP.
